Subject: Fy24 special technical operations planner selection panel results
1. Per reference (c), the Special Technical Operations Free MOS (8016) Selection Panel convened from 01-04 Jun 2026. The panel reviewed 19 applications and selected 19 Marines. A memorandum with the list of Marines selected is posted on the SIPRNET SharePoint site: https:(slash)(slash)
intelshare.intelink.sgov.gov…. A copy of the memorandum will be distributed to the STO Chiefs at all MEFs and MARFORs.
2. Marines are instructed to submit this memorandum via EPAR to their local administration center, which will enter the appropriate entry in their Official Military Personnel File to reflect the FMOS.
3. Commanders are encouraged to utilize Marines with the 8016 FMOS in accordance with reference (a) to provide material contribution to service STO efforts through exercise support, wargaming, and crisis and contingency operations planning.
